BANGALORE: Telelogic (Stockholm Exchange: TLOG), the leading global provider of solutions for advanced systems and software development, today announced the setup of its product development lab in Bangalore, India. This is Telelogic's 4th Product Development Lab, the others being in US, UK and Sweden. The Bangalore Lab will initially focus on performing test and quality assurance of Telelogic's integrated product offering. The Bangalore lab will start off with 20-50 engineers and would ramp up on a need basis over time. "Telelogic's operation in India is now the fourth largest in the Telelogic group," said Anders Lidbeck, President & CEO of Telelogic. "We have previously built up a local sales and support organization but also a global support and a global telemarketing operation in India with great success. India has developed into one of the major countries in high tech, with many skilled IT professionals. We now feel that we have the experience and infrastructure in place to take this one step further by setting up a product development lab in Bangalore, complementing our development labs in Europe and the US. This will over time significantly increase our development capacity and help us deliver even better products faster to market", Lidbeck concludes. Sreehari Narasipur has been appointed as the Vice President of Development for the Bangalore Development Lab. Sreehari joins Telelogic from an impressive 5 plus years history with Oracle India where he held various management positions and managed multiple project teams in Enterprise Internet Tools and Oracle Portal divisions in the Oracle India Development Center in Bangalore. Sreehari has more than 21 years experience from software development in high quality organizations which include both strong process orientation and practical hands-on experience from development of advanced products for a demanding market. Prior to his tenure at Oracle, Sreehari had a distinguished history of working with Xerox Corporation and other companies, both in the US and in India. Sreehari holds a Master of Technology from the Indian Institute of Technology in Madras, India. Telelogic has been present in the Indian market since April 2001. It has grown from an employee strength of 3 people to a full-fledged operation with around 80 people. The operations in India currently include sales, professional services and a global support center which provides technical support 24X5 to all Telelogic customers worldwide. "The Product Development Lab in India will further Telelogic's commitment to the Indian market" said Sidharth Malik, Managing Director of Telelogic India. "The product development lab in India will help Telelogic in furthering its Automated Lifecycle Management (ALM) strategy by supporting the market needs of requirements-driven development and test, together with integrated change and defect management" said Ingemar Ljungdahl, CTO of Telelogic.
